技术文档

https 证书 验证

时间 : 2024-11-06 23:25:01浏览量 : 6

在当今数字化的时代,网络安全成为了至关重要的议题,而 https 证书验证则是保障网络安全的重要环节之一。https,即超文本传输安全协议,它通过在 HTTP 协议基础上添加了 SSL/TLS 加密层,为用户与网站之间的通信提供了加密和身份验证,确保数据在传输过程中的机密性、完整性和真实性。

https 证书验证的核心在于验证网站的身份。当用户访问一个 https 网站时,浏览器会与网站的服务器进行交互,请求验证网站的 https 证书。证书由受信任的证书颁发机构(CA)签发,CA 会对网站的身份进行严格的审核,包括网站的所有者信息、域名的合法性等。只有经过 CA 验证通过的网站,其 https 证书才会被浏览器视为合法可信的。

在 https 证书验证过程中,主要涉及到以下几个关键步骤。浏览器向网站的服务器发送一个请求,要求获取该网站的 https 证书。服务器接收到请求后,会将其 https 证书发送给浏览器。浏览器接收到证书后,会对证书的合法性进行验证。这包括验证证书的颁发机构是否可信,证书的有效期是否有效,以及证书中的域名是否与正在访问的网站域名一致等。如果证书通过了验证,浏览器会继续与服务器进行加密通信;如果证书验证失败,浏览器会显示警告信息,提醒用户该网站的安全性存在问题。

https 证书验证的重要性不言而喻。它可以防止中间人攻击,即攻击者在用户与网站之间插入自己的设备,窃取用户的敏感信息。通过加密通信,即使攻击者截获了数据,也无法解密其内容。https 证书验证还可以防止网站被假冒,确保用户访问的是真正的目标网站,而不是被恶意仿冒的钓鱼网站。在电子商务、在线银行等涉及到用户敏感信息的领域,https 证书验证更是必不可少,它为用户提供了一个安全的交易环境,增强了用户对网站的信任度。

为了确保 https 证书的合法性和安全性,CA 机构需要遵循严格的认证标准和流程。CA 机构会对网站的所有者进行身份验证,要求提供相关的身份证明文件和网站所有权证明等。同时,CA 机构还会对网站的安全性进行评估,确保网站没有存在明显的安全漏洞。CA 机构的自身安全性也非常重要,它们需要采取严格的安全措施,防止证书被篡改或泄露。

在实际应用中,我们可以通过查看浏览器地址栏中的锁形图标来判断一个网站是否使用了 https 证书。当锁形图标显示为绿色时,表示该网站的 https 证书是合法可信的;当锁形图标显示为红色或其他颜色时,表示该网站的 https 证书存在问题或验证失败。我们还可以通过点击锁形图标,查看证书的详细信息,包括证书的颁发机构、有效期、域名等。

https 证书验证是保障网络安全的重要手段之一。它通过验证网站的身份,为用户与网站之间的通信提供了加密和身份验证,确保数据的安全传输。在使用互联网的过程中,我们应该重视 https 证书验证的作用,选择使用合法可信的 https 网站,以保护自己的隐私和安全。同时,CA 机构也应该不断加强自身的管理和监督,确保 https 证书的合法性和安全性,为用户提供一个更加安全可靠的网络环境。